Output 103e1cfe7398f5b941b743c902897fc0bf15d4eac7c5bb3f72b25b277ba60c0e:1

value
2467077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234ae4a8f4d796655a329db3a628f6d4ecc3eabd OP_EQUAL
address
34udHvpia5kWU1zEMPS7k3zTzF6YV6tnja
transaction
103e1cfe7398f5b941b743c902897fc0bf15d4eac7c5bb3f72b25b277ba60c0e
spent
true